目的:探讨血清尿酸水平与老年轻度高血压患者的内皮功能相关性。方法:选取我院2020年1月到2020年12月共收治的200例老年轻度高血压患者作为研究对象,所有患者均为未使用过降压药物治疗,将其分为轻度高血压组。另选取同期收治的200例高血压常规药物治疗患者作为重度高血压组与200名健康者作为对照组,对比三组患者血清尿酸水平与血管内皮功能。对观察组所有患者依照血清尿酸水平进行分组,将血清尿酸水平208-360μmol/L的患者分为低尿酸组,共计136例,将血清尿酸水平≥360μmol/L的患者分为高尿酸组,共计64例。对比两组患者的一般临床指标、血管内皮功能与氧化应激指标,并分析血清尿酸水平与老年轻度高血压患者的内皮功能相关性。结果:重度、轻度高血压组与对照组患者NO、ET-1、SUA水平对比差异显著,具有统计学意义(P<0.05);高尿酸组与低尿酸组患者TG、TC、DBP、SBP水平对比无明显差异(P>0.05),高尿酸组患者Cr水平高于低尿酸组,组间对比,差异具有统计学意义(P<0.05);高尿酸组与低尿酸组患者T-AOC、GSH-Px、LHP、MDA、NO、ET-1水平对比差异显著,高尿酸组患者LHP、MDA和ET-1水平明显高于低尿酸组,高尿酸组患者T-AOC、GSH-Px、NO水平明显低于低尿酸组,组间对比,差异具有统计学意义(P>0.05);Spearman相关分析结果显示:TG、TC、Cr、DBP、SBP与血尿酸水平无明显相关性(P>0.05),T-AOC、GSH-Px、NO与血清尿酸水平呈负相关(P<0.05),LHP、MDA、ET-1与血清尿酸水平呈正相关(P<0.05)。结论:血清尿酸水平与老年轻度高血压患者的内皮功能具有明显相关性,而且证明血尿酸水平的升高可能由患者氧化应激导致,因此氧化应激水平也是引起血管内皮功能障碍的一种潜在机制,希望本研究结果能够为高血压患者的疾病控制提供参考意见。  相似文献

目的:探讨血清尿酸(UA)水平对急性脑梗死患者颈动脉粥样硬化斑块的影响。方法:回顾性分析2011年6月至2016年1月我院收治的251例急性脑梗死患者的临床资料,根据有无颈动脉粥样硬化斑块分为伴颈动脉粥样硬化斑块组(观察组)176例和无颈动脉粥样硬化斑块组(对照组)75例,观察组根据颈动脉粥样硬化程度分为斑块形成组(113例)、内中膜增厚组(63例),根据颈动脉斑块稳定程度分为不稳定组(106例)、稳定组(70例),比较各组血清UA水平,根据UA水平不同分为高UA组(134例)和正常UA组(117例),进行颈动脉斑块发生情况比较。结果:观察组的血清UA水平显著高于对照组,差异有统计学意义(P0.05)。(1)斑块形成组和内中膜增厚组血清UA水平显著高于对照组(P0.05),而斑块形成组和内中膜增厚组血清UA水平比较,差异无统计学意义(P0.05);(2)不稳定组血清UA水平显著高于对照组和稳定组(P0.05),而稳定组和对照组血清UA水平比较,差异无统计学意义(P0.05);(3)正常UA组和高UA组颈动脉斑块的发生情况比较,差异无统计学意义(P0.05)。结论:血清UA水平可以作为表征急性脑梗死患者伴随出现颈动脉粥样硬化斑块的生物学指标之一,此外,血清UA的水平在颈动脉粥样硬化斑块形成者和不稳定者表达更高,但血清UA水平与颈动脉斑块形成无明显联系。  相似文献

目的:比较腔隙性(LI)与非腔隙性(NLI)脑梗塞患者血压变化,评价血压与腔隙性脑梗塞的相关性。方法:选取在我院住院治疗的249例急性脑梗塞患者,根据不同亚型将患者分为腔隙性脑梗塞组(LI组,n=187)与非腔隙性脑梗塞组(NLI组,n=62),比较两组患者血压差异,采用线性相关分析与cox相关分析评估血压与脑梗塞及其危险因素的相关性。结果:LI组患者入院3天收缩压、舒张压显著高于NLI患者组,差异有统计学意义(分别P=0.003,P=0.009);线性回归分析表明,入院时收缩压、入院第3天收缩压、入院第3天舒张压与LI显著相关(均P0.05);cox单因素与多因素分析表明,入院第3天收缩压与LI显著相关(分别P=0.009与P=0.006),与其他协变量不相关(均P0.05)。而患者出院时血压与m RS或NIHSS不相关(分别P=0.788和P=0.898)。结论:与相同严重程度NLI患者比较,LI患者高血压与LI独立相关。LI患者血压显著高于NLI患者,二者差异虽与临床疾病严重程度无关,但很可能是患者发生急性脑梗塞的根本原因。  相似文献

摘要 目的:研究腔隙性脑梗死(LI)伴脑白质病变(WML)患者血清miR-146a和神经元特异性烯纯化酶(NSE)水平与蒙特利尔认知评估量表(MoCA)评分的关系。方法:纳入我院从2017年3月~2019年3月收治的LI伴WML患者108例进行研究,记作LI伴WML组。另取同期收治的单纯WML患者与单纯LI患者各100例,分别记作WML组与LI组,再取同期于我院进行体检的健康人员100例作为对照组。比较四组人员的血清miR-146a和NSE水平、MoCA评分,并作相关性分析。结果:LI伴WML组、WML组、LI组血清miR-146a相对表达量均低于对照组,而LI伴WML组血清miR-146a相对表达量又显著低于WML组、LI组(均P<0.05);LI伴WML组、WML组、LI组血清NSE水平均显著高于对照组,且LI伴WML组血清NSE水平均显著高于WML组、LI组(均P<0.05)。LI伴WML组MoCA总分显著低于WML组与LI组,且WML组与LI组MoCA总分显著低于对照组(均P<0.05)。经Pearson相关性分析可得:LI伴WML组患者血清miR-146a相对表达量与MoCA总分呈正相关关系(P<0.05),而血清NSE水平与MoCA总分呈负相关关系(P<0.05)。结论:LI伴WML患者的血清miR-146a水平存在明显低表达,而NSE水平存在明显高表达,并与MoCA评分相关,两者可能在认知功能损伤的发生、发展过程中起着至关重要的作用。  相似文献

目的:分析2011~2014 年我院体检者血压水平与血清尿酸(UA)水平的关系。方法:选择我院2011~2014 年2150 例体检者为 研究对象,均完成血压(SBP、DBP),心率(HR)、身高、体重指数(BMI)、空腹血糖(FPG)、高密度脂蛋白胆固醇(HDL-C) 、低密度脂 蛋白胆固醇(LDL-C) 、血清总胆固醇(TC) 、甘油三酯(TG)及UA 指标检测,并对检测结果进行分析。结果:2150 例体检人群中,高 血压为860 人,占40.0%,高血压组BMI、FPG、LDL-C、TC、TG 及UA 均明显高于非高血压组,而HDL-C 明显低于非高血压组, 比较差异具有统计学意义(P<0.05);多因素Logistic 回归分析显示,上述指标均为高血压的独立危险因素(P<0.05)。结论:血压 水平的升高与UA水平具有密切联系,早期控制UA水平对预防高血压的发生具有重要意义。  相似文献

目的:探讨脑小血管病(Cerebral small vessel disease,CSVD)患者血清尿酸(Uric acid,UA)水平和步态障碍之间的相关性。方法:将我院自2018年1月至2019年1月收治的CSVD患者172例作为研究对象,根据患者血清尿酸水平分为研究组87例,对照组85例。收集和比较两组的临床资料,使用Logistic回归分析血清尿酸和CSVD患者脑室旁、深部白质高信号、步态障碍之间的相关性。结果:两组的年龄、性别、体质指数、血糖指标、血脂指标水平,合并高血压、糖尿病病史和吸烟情况比较差异无统计学意义(P0.05)。研究组血清尿酸水平、饮酒患者比例明显高于对照组(P0.05),脑室旁高信号和深部白质高信号中重度比例均明显高于对照组(P0.05);将步态障碍、脑室旁高信号与深部白质高信号作为影响因素带入相关分析,结果显示血清尿酸水平与步态障碍、脑室旁高信号与深部白质高信号比较存在正相关(P0.05)。结论:CSVD患者血清高尿酸水平与脑室旁、深部白质高信号病变程度呈明显的正相关性,也是患者步态障碍的影响因素。  相似文献

目的:观察妊娠期高血压孕产妇尿酸与Nod样受体蛋白3(nucleotide-binding oligomerization domain-leucine-rich repeats containing pyrin domain 3,NLRP3)炎症小体表达,分析二者与疾病的相关性,为妊娠期高血压的诊断提供参考。方法:选择我院产科2016年3月至2019年3月常规产检并诊断为妊娠期高血压孕产妇200例为研究组,参照《妊娠期高血压诊治指南(2015)》中各妊娠期高血压分级标准将研究组200例孕产妇分为妊娠期高血压组(86例)、轻度子痫前期组(57例)、重度子痫前期组(57例),另选择同期在我院接受常规产检的200例健康孕产妇作为对照组。检测并比较4组孕产妇血清尿酸、NLRP3炎症小体m RNA及NLRP3蛋白表达,经双变量Spearman相关性分析检验各指标与疾病的相关性。结果:4组孕产妇年龄、孕周、孕次、产次等一般资料比较差异无统计学意义(P>0.05);重度子痫前期组血清尿酸水平、NLRP3 mRNA及NLRP3蛋白表达最高,后由高至低依次为轻度子痫前期组、妊娠期高血压组、对照组,组间两两比较差异均有统计学意义(P<0.05);经双变量Spearman相关性分析检验证实,血清尿酸、NLRP3 mRNA表达和蛋白表达与妊娠期高血压发生发展均呈正相关(r=0.709、0.833、0.693,P均<0.001)。结论:妊娠期高血压孕产妇血清尿酸与NLRP3炎症小体水平上调,且随着孕产妇病情的加重升高,可考虑将其作为妊娠期高血压疾病早期诊断及预后评估的血清学参考指标。  相似文献

目的:探讨老年高血压合并2 型糖尿病患者血清同型半胱氨酸(Homocysteine, Hcy)、血尿酸(Serum uric acid, SUA)水平变 化及其临床意义。方法:2012 年9 月至2013 年9 月期间,我院诊治的40 例单纯高血压和40 例高血压合并2 型糖尿病患者,分别 作为对照组和研究组,检测两组血清Hcy、SUA水平。结果:两组患者收缩压、舒张压比较无统计学差异(P>0.05)。研究组空腹血 糖、餐后2h 血糖、血清Hcy、SUA 均显著高于对照组(P<0.05)。研究组中血管并发症患者血清Hcy、SUA为(25.0± 5.0)umol/L 和 (390.0± 65.0)mmol/L显著高于无血管并发症患者(17.0± 4.0)umol/L 和(330.0± 55.0)mmol/L,血管并发症患者FBG、餐后2h 血 糖与无血管并发症患者比较无统计学差异(P>0.05)。结论:高血压合并2 型糖尿病患者血清Hcy、SUA异常升高,且存在慢性血 管并发症患者两者水平更高,血清Hcy、SUA是老年高血压合并2 型糖尿病的危险因素。  相似文献

目的:探讨急性非ST段抬高性心肌梗死(NSTEMI)患者血清尿酸水平与N末端B型钠尿肽原(NT-pro BNP)的相关性分析。方法:将143例NSTEMI患者按照入院时血清尿酸四分位数分为四组:Ⅰ组(尿酸284.18μmol/L)、Ⅱ组(284.19~336.53μmol/L),Ⅲ组(336.54~390.78μmol/L),Ⅳ(尿酸390.79μmol/L);按照血清NT-pro BNP中位数分为2组:NT-pro BNP571.56 pg/m L组和NT-pro BNP≥571.56 pg/m L组;比较各组相关指标的差异。结果:Ⅰ组、Ⅱ组、Ⅲ组及Ⅳ组四组的NT-pro BNP、GRACE危险评分、CK-MB、LEVF、c Tn I比较统计学差异(P0.05),Ⅳ组NT-pro BNP、GRACE危险评分、c Tn I、CK-MB高于Ⅰ组、Ⅱ组、Ⅲ组,Ⅲ组高于Ⅰ组、Ⅱ组(P0.05);NT-pro BNP≥571.56 pg/m L组血清尿酸、GRACE危险评分、c Tn I、CK-MB高于NT-pro BNP571.56pg/m L组(P0.05)。血清尿酸分别与NT-pro BNP、GRACE危险评分呈现正相关(P0.05)。结论:血清尿酸水平与NSTEMI患者的NT-pro BNP密切相关,临床检测血清尿酸水平对于评估NSTEMI患者NT-pro BNP水平具有重要的意义。  相似文献

Background: Coronary artery disease as a consequence of atherosclerosis is the most common cause of morbidity and mortality in type 2 Diabetes Mellitus (DM) patients. Homocysteine (HCY), as one of the risk factors, and uric acid (UA) as the most common antioxidant in serum have their roles in the processes of inflammation and atherogenesis, which underlie the pathogenesis of acute myocardial infarction (AMI). The effect of HCY in cardiovascular disease is thought to be manifested primarily through oxidative damage, implying a potential correlation between the HCY level and antioxidant status. Since the data related to the diagnostic significance of both HCY and UA in diabetic patients with AMI are conflicting, and so far not reported in Bosnian patients, this research aimed to examine the association of HCY and UA levels with glomerular filtration rate (eGFR) and explore the pathophysiological significance of these data in Bosnian diabetic patients with AMI. Methods: This prospective research included 52 DM type 2 patients diagnosed with AMI. Blood samples were taken on admission and used for biochemical analysis. Results of the biochemical analyses were statistically analysed. Results: Elevated HCY and UA levels were observed in diabetic patients. Females have higher HCY compared to males. A positive correlation was revealed between HCY and UA and was confirmed with different HCY levels in subgroups with different UA level. A negative correlation was observed between UA and HbA1c, as well as between both HCY and UA with eGFR. Conclusions: These results contribute to the clarification of the biochemical mechanisms characteristic in AMI patients with DM. According to these results, we believe that joint measurement of HCY and UA could enable a better assessment of the prognosis for this group of patients. This kind of assessment, as well as regression analysis, can identify high-risk patients at an earlier stage when appropriate interventions can influence a better outcome in such patients.  相似文献

目的探讨血尿酸水平与急性脑梗死发病及预后的关系。方法检测129例急性脑梗死患者与120例健康组的血尿酸水平及相关指标进行比较,分析其相关性。结果急性脑梗死患者血尿酸水平及异常率明显增高,与对照组之间差异存在非常显著性(P0.01),在急性脑梗死患者中,血尿酸异常组高血压、高血糖、高血脂及高纤维蛋白原血症的发生率比正常组明显增高,血尿酸异常组较正常组入院第21天神经功能缺损的程度差异存在非常显著性(P0.01)。结论血尿酸水平与急性脑梗死的发病密切相关,是预后不良的预测因素。  相似文献

Phytic acid, a constituent of various plants, has been related to health benefits. Phytic acid has been shown to inhibit purine nucleotide metabolism in vitro and suppress elevation of plasma uric acid levels after purine administration in animal models. This study investigated the effect of phytic acid on postprandial serum uric acid (SUA) in humans. This randomized, double-blind, crossover design study included 48 healthy subjects with normal fasting SUA. Subjects consumed a control drink and a phytic acid drink with purine-rich food, and serum and urine uric acid levels were measured for 360?min after purine loading. Phytic acid lowered the incremental area under the curve (0–360?min) and incremental maximum concentration of SUA after purine loading (p?<?0.05); tended to lower cumulative urinary uric acid excretion (0–360?min) after purine loading (p?<?0.10); and suppressed postprandial SUA in this clinical study. Altogether, our findings suggest that phytic acid may play a beneficial role in controlling postprandial SUA.  相似文献

Multiterritorial atherosclerosis has dramatically increased annual risk of adverse cardiovascular events than atherosclerotic disease with single‐artery affected. Serum uric acid (SUA) is an important predictor of stroke and atherosclerosis; however, which is supported by few direct evidence based on cohort studies. A prospective cohort study including 2644 North Chinese adults aged ≥40 years was performed in 2010‐2012 to investigate the association between SUA and multiterritorial vascular stenosis. Hyperuricaemia was defined as SUA levels >6 and >7 mg/dL for males and females, respectively. All participants underwent twice transcranial Doppler (TCD) and bilateral carotid duplex ultrasound to evaluate intracranial artery stenosis (ICAS) and extracranial arterial stenosis (ECAS) and peripheral arterial disease (PAD) was determined by ankle‐brachial index (ABI) on January 2010 and January 2012 based on regular health check‐ups. The cumulative incidence of vascular stenosis was significantly higher in subjects with hyperuricaemia than in those without hyperuricaemia (54.1% vs. 34.7%, P < 0.001). The adjusted odds ratios (ORs) with 95% confidence intervals (CIs) for new on‐set vascular stenosis due to hyperuricaemia and a 1‐mg/dL change in SUA level were 1.75 (1.32‐2.31) and 1.29 (1.21‐1.38), respectively. Furthermore, in the gender‐stratified analysis, the association between SUA levels and ICAS was statistically significant in males (OR: 2.02; 95% CI: 1.18‐3.46), but not females (OR: 0.85, 95% CI: 0.41‐1.76, P for interaction: 0.026).  相似文献

目的:研究脑梗死患者空腹血浆总同型半胱氨酸(THCY)水平及其与血脂的关系。方法:观察组(54例)均为我院2002年1月.2006年5月住院脑梗死患者,测定空腹THCY水平及血脂各参数;另有同龄健康者为对照组(39例),进行比较分析。结果:观察组与对照组比较,空腹THCY水平差异有统计学意义(P〈0.05),血浆HCY含量与TC、TG、HDL-C、LDL-C含量的相关性均无统计学意义。结论:高HCY血症与血脂无关,是脑梗死的独立危险因素之一。  相似文献

Serum uric acid (SUA) is a new therapeutic target for non‐alcoholic fatty liver disease (NAFLD). In this study, we introduced a chemiluminescence (CL) method combined with microarray technology and a simple fabrication procedure to obtain a highly sensitive SUA probe based on a mesoporous metal oxide nanomaterial. The high‐throughput method was based on the generation of H2O2 from SUA by immobilized uricase and its measurement by a CL reaction catalyzed by mesoporous metal oxide nanomaterials. The CL probe was designed for SUA The linear range of the uric acid concentration was 0.6–9 μM and the detection limit was 0.1 μM. In comparison with the other SUA detection techniques, this method has the advantages of a low detection limit, high sensitivity and simplicity. A new sensitive high‐throughput approach was obtained for the determination of SUA.  相似文献

A simple and reliable HPLC method for quantitative determination of pseudouridine and uric acid in human urine and serum using a cation-exchange resin is described. This method is straightforward (12 runs of urine samples per day since the sample is only diluted into buffer and then chromatographed), sensitive, and highly reproducible. The column is stable over long periods (3 months of uninterrupted use at a time; it is thereafter easily restored to the original state). Mean excretion values for pseudouridine (in μmol/mmol creatinine) are 26.4 ± 3.1 (17 female adults), 23.8 ± 2.5 (12 male adults), 164.7 ± 32.2 (37 male preterm infants); mean values for uric acid (μmol/mmol creatinine) are, respectively, 310.3 ± 90.5, 278.2 ± 56.1, and 1108 ± 314. Human serum is deproteinized by pressure ultrafiltration in microcollodion bags with a nominal exclusion molecular weight of 12,400 and then put directly onto the HPLC column. The complete procedure takes 4 h.  相似文献

目的探讨老年冠心病患者血尿酸(SUA)水平与肠道菌群的关系,为该类患者的治疗提供参考。方法选择2018年5月至2019年5月我院收治的83例冠心病患者为研究组,选择同期我院83例健康体检者的作为对照组。比较两组对象SUA水平及粪便标本中肠道菌群分布情况(乳杆菌、双歧杆菌、幽门螺杆菌、大肠埃希菌、链球菌);比较不同菌群紊乱程度冠心病患者SUA水平;比较不同SUA水平冠心病患者肠道菌群分布情况。采用Pearson相关分析冠心病患者SUA水平与肠道菌群相关性。结果研究组患者肠道乳杆菌、双歧杆菌数量明显低于对照组(均P<0.05),而肠道幽门螺杆菌、大肠埃希菌、链球菌数量明显高于对照组(均P<0.05)。研究组患者SUA水平明显高于对照组(P<0.05),不同菌群紊乱程度冠心病患者SUA水平有差异有统计学意义(均P<0.05)。不同SUA水平冠心病患者肠道乳杆菌、双歧杆菌、幽门螺杆菌、大肠埃希菌、链球菌数量差异有统计学意义(均P<0.05)。冠心病患者SUA水平与肠道乳杆菌、双歧杆菌数量呈负相关(r=-0.872、-0.912,均P<0.001),与肠道幽门螺杆菌、大肠埃希菌、链球菌数量呈正相关(r=0.915、0.896、0.889,均P<0.001)。结论冠心病患者存在肠道细菌紊乱及高尿酸现象。冠心病患者SUA水平与肠道菌群显著相关,检测冠心病患者SUA水平对监测肠道菌群状态及治疗方案制定具有重要意义。  相似文献

Serum uric acid levels are maintained by urate synthesis and excretion. URAT1 (coded by SLC22CA12) was recently proposed to be the major absorptive urate transporter protein in the kidney regulating blood urate levels. Because genetic background is known to affect serum urate levels, we hypothesized that genetic variations in SLC22A12 may predispose humans to hyperuricemia and gout. We investigated rs893006 polymorphism (GG, GT and TT) in SLC22A12 in a total of 326 Japanese subjects. Differences in clinical characteristics among the genotype groups were tested by the analysis of variance (ANOVA). In male subjects, mean serum uric acid levels were significantly different among the three genotypes. Levels in the GG genotype subjects were the highest, followed by those with the GT and TT genotypes. However, no differences between the groups were seen in the distributions of creatinine, Fasting plasma glucose (FPG), HbA(1c), total cholesterol, triglyceride, HDL cholesterol levels or BMI. A single nucleotide polymorphism (SNP) in the urate transporter gene SLC22CA12 was found to be associated with elevated serum uric acid levels among Japanese subjects. This SNP may be an independent genetic marker for predicting hyperuricemia.  相似文献

Objective: To assess the effect of baseline serum calcium on the progression of periodontal disease in non‐institutionalized elderly. Background: Although a few studies have found some evidence of the role played by dietary calcium in periodontal disease process, there is a paucity of information pertinent to longitudinal assessment of serum calcium‐periodontal relationships. Material and methods: Clinical attachment levels of 266 Japanese subjects aged 70 years were recorded at baseline and annually for six consecutive years. Progression of periodontal disease (PPD) was defined as the number of teeth that showed additional attachment loss of ≥3 mm during the 6 years. The number of PPD was calculated for each subject and categorised into four levels, namely, PPD0, PPD1, PPD2 and PPD3 where the number of teeth with additional attachment loss ranged from 0, 1–10, 11–20 and >20 respectively. The levels of serum calcium, albumin, random blood sugar, immunoglobulin (IgG, IgA and IgM), gender, smoking habits, education, gingival bleeding and the number of teeth present were obtained at baseline. Results: Serum calcium, IgA, smoking, gingival bleeding and teeth present were associated with PPD at p ≤ 0.10 and were included in a multinomial logistic regression analysis. Serum calcium was the only variable that was significantly associated with PPD with relative risks of 100 at PPD1 and PPD2, respectively, and 1000 at PPD3. Conclusion: Serum calcium may be considered a risk factor for periodontal disease progression in non‐institutionalized elderly.  相似文献
